Detailed Description
The invention will be further described with reference to the following figures 1-9 and examples:
the utility model provides a charger baby which can clamp a mobile phone, comprising an upper shell 1, a lower shell 2, a storage battery 8, a circuit board, a processor connected with the circuit board, an input interface 3 and an output interface 5, wherein the circuit board has the main functions of controlling voltage and current in the input and output processes and also can realize other functions such as illumination and electric quantity display; the storage battery 8 is used as a container for storing electric quantity, and currently, the mainstream storage battery 8 is divided into a polymer lithium battery cell and a 18650 battery cell. The circuit board, and the processor, the input interface 3 and the output interface 5 connected to the circuit board are all in the prior art, and are not described herein in detail. The utility model discloses still include the cell-phone fixture, the cell-phone fixture includes movable plate I9, movable plate II 11, holder I6, holder II 15 and connecting axle 10, and movable plate I9 and movable plate II 11 are the same in structure, movable plate I9 and movable plate II 11 set up relatively to can follow length direction relative movement, holder I6 and holder II 15 are the same in structure, holder I6 and holder II 15 set up relatively to, and relatively fixed in the circumference through connecting axle 10, holder I6 and holder II 15 respectively with movable plate I9 and movable plate II 11's tip axial fixity, circumference activity; that is, the clamp i 6 and the clamp ii 15 are rotatable with respect to the moving plate i 9 and the moving plate ii 11. Further, holder I6 and holder II 15 can be for casing length direction rotation 0 ~ 90 down.
Further, the lower shell 2 comprises a cavity for placing the storage battery 8, through grooves 204 penetrating through the side wall of the lower shell 2 are formed in two sides of the lower shell 2, the through grooves 204 are located above the cavity, a fixing pin 205 is vertically arranged in the center of the through grooves 204, a large interface hole 202 and a small interface hole 203 penetrating through the lower side wall are formed in the lower side surface of the lower shell 2, the output interface 5 of the charger runs out of the large interface hole 202, and the input interface 3 runs out of the small interface hole 203; an external power supply charges the charger baby through the input interface 3, and the charger baby charges the mobile phone or other equipment through the output interface 5; the bottom of the lower shell 2 is also vertically provided with a lower interface groove 201 connected with the lower side wall of the lower shell 2.
Further, the mobile phone clamping mechanism further comprises a gear 14, a tension spring I12 and a tension spring II 13, the tension spring I12 and the tension spring II 13 are identical in structure, racks 901 are arranged in the length directions of the moving plate I9 and the moving plate II 11, the two racks 901 are arranged oppositely, the gear 14 is mounted on the fixing pin 205 of the lower shell 2, and the two racks 901 are located on the upper side and the lower side of the gear 14 and are in transmission fit with the gear 14; one end of each tension spring I12 and one end of each tension spring II 13 are fixedly connected with the left end and the right end of the lower shell in the through groove, and the other ends of the tension springs I12 and the tension springs II 13 are fixedly connected with the outer ends of the moving plates I9 and II 11. Through the arrangement, under the initial state, the movable plate I9 and the movable plate II 11 are under the action of the tension spring I12 and the tension spring II 13 and contract relatively, so that the positions of the clamping piece I6 and the clamping piece II 15 contract relatively, when the mobile phone needs to be clamped, only the clamping piece I6 or the clamping piece II 15 needs to be moved, the distance between the clamping piece II 15 and the clamping piece I6 is increased due to the cooperation of the gear and the rack 14, and after the mobile phone is placed, the tension of the tension spring I12 and the tension spring II 13 keeps the mobile phone in a tightened state.
Further, the upper shell 1 comprises two pressure plates 102 arranged in parallel above the inside, a cavity 103 is formed between the two pressure plates 102, and the cavity 103 corresponds to the through groove on the lower shell up and down; the bottom of the upper shell 1 is also vertically provided with an interface upper groove 101 connected with the lower side wall of the upper shell 1, and the interface upper groove 101 corresponds to the interface lower groove 201 up and down. Further, the upper shell 1 and the lower shell are detachably connected.
Further, the clamping piece I6 comprises a clamping shaft 62 and a buckle 61 arranged at one end of the clamping shaft 62, the buckle 61 is used for clamping the mobile phone, the front end of the buckle 61 is inwards bent and arc-shaped, a cross hole 63 is formed in the end face of the other end of the clamping shaft 62, and as another preferred mode, one of the cross hole and the spline hole is formed in the end face of the other end of the clamping shaft 62.
Further, cell-phone fixture still includes connecting axle 10, in the cross hole 63 of holder I6 was inserted to the one end of connecting axle 10, in the cross hole 63 of the other end inserted holder II, the cross-section of connecting axle 10 was the cross, realized the circumference location of holder I6 and holder II. As another preference, the section of the connecting shaft 10 is one of a cross shape or a spline shape.
Further, still including the interface 4 that charges, the interface 4 that charges is located the interface of casing down in groove 201, and can follow the interface and move about the interface under groove 201 within range from top to bottom, still includes lifting spring 7, lifting spring 7 sets up in the interface of casing down in groove 201, lifting spring 7's one end links firmly with 4 bottoms of the interface that charges, and when last casing 1 and casing combination down, lifting spring 7's the other end and last casing 1 interface upper groove 101 inner wall contact are connected. When needing to charge, upwards remove interface 4 that charges, will charge interface 4 and be connected with the cell-phone, can charge, interface 4 that charges can follow the interface and descend the groove within range from top to bottom and remove, adapts to the cell-phone of different thickness. When charging is not needed, the mobile phone is disconnected, and the charging interface 4 is reset to the lower slot of the interface under the action of the lifting spring 7.
The utility model drives the clamping and the loosening of the two buckles by moving the clamping piece I6 or the clamping piece II, so as to realize the clamping and the loosening of the mobile phone, and the charger body can be used as a mobile phone bracket after clamping the mobile phone; when the mobile phone needs to be charged, the charging interface 4 is moved upwards, the charging interface is connected with the mobile phone, and then charging can be carried out, and the charging interface can move in the vertical range along the lower groove of the interface, so that the mobile phone is suitable for mobile phones with different thicknesses. When charging is not needed, the mobile phone is disconnected, and the charging interface is reset to the lower slot of the interface under the action of the lifting spring 7.
